Paul Cook’s men host the Shrimpers at the Technique Stadium and will be hoping to extend their unbeaten start to the season which has led them to the top of the table.

The visitors are one of the favourites to finish in the play-offs but have had a mixed start so far.

  • FT: Chesterfield 3 v 2 Southend United (7.45pm KO)
  • Spireites stay top and unbeaten after thrilling comeback with 10-men
  • Clarke scores opener on 19 minutes; Powell equalises; Banks sent off before HT; Dackers for 1-2 on 46 mins; Quigley for 2-2
  • King screamer for 3-2
  • Minute’s silence for Queen before game
